Lara Latture, CHA, is southern hospitality at her core. As president of Northwest x Southern Hospitality, Lara is at the helm of what works in hospitality with her wit, no-nonsense business approach, and genuine understanding of the industry. The Northwest x Southern portfolio consists of 20 hotels within Washington, Oregon, Idaho and Alaska, and Mrs. Latture oversees the continued growth of the hotels and the company’s expanding footprint. The growth in the last few years has centered around brand partners Hilton, Marriott International, and Hyatt Hotels Corporation
Lara’s early work career began in retail with Parisian Department Stores. She credits their great training programs with developing her keen marketing and sales skills, but her big smile and pat-on-the-back management style moved her up the career ladder. Her hospitality experience is a true testament to working from the ground up. She began her career as a director of sales selling mobile entertainment space, then as a GM, director of operations and her most recent role: chief operating officer and executive vice president of The Hotel Group for the last 20 years.
With over 30 years in the hospitality industry, Mrs. Latture has maintained her focus of being fair, consistent and no-nonsense. These priorities have served her well over the years, as she spends most of her time focused on operations and forward-looking initiatives for the company as a whole or involved in promoting brand initiatives that are beneficial for both guests and employees. As an active member of Marriott’s Courtyard Franchise Advisory Council, and Hyatt’s Select Franchise Advisory Board, and previously having served several terms on the Hilton Garden Inn Owner’s Advisory Council, IHG’s Crowne Plaza Owners Association, as well as Hilton’s DoubleTree Owners Advisory Council, Mrs. Latture is actively engaged with every facet of the hotel business. As President, Mrs. Latture has cultivated an environment of ‘walking the talk’ and her team lives this every day, most of whom have worked with her for a minimum of 10 years.
Lara leads hotel operations, sales and marketing, renovation and construction, HR and more in her fast-paced world.
